Bio

Ms. McCarroll joined Coughlin & Gerhart, LLP, in 2023, following in-house counsel in the technology
and private equity spaces. Prior to joining the firm, she also worked as an Attorney Advisor for the
Small Business Administration. Ms. McCarroll has experience with development and negotiation of
managed care services contracts, NDAs, employment agreements, policy and procurement documents,
and various other contracts. In addition, she has advised on compliance issues and healthcare legal
issues, and used legal research techniques to review cases and develop recommendations. Ms. McCarroll
is an associate in the firm and concentrates on Real Estate Law, Trusts & Estates, and Business &
Banking Law. She is a member of the Mental Health Law & New Lawyers Institute Committees for the
New York City Bar Association, the Metropolitan Black Bar Association, and the Young Lawyers and
Women Lawyer Divisions for the National Bar Association. Ms. McCarroll is an active member of Delta
Sigma Theta Sorority, Incorporated.
